Impressive Results at Surf Club Nationals

-

A total of 1350 senior surf athletes from 44 clubs around the country contested this season’s Surf Sports Nationals, with East End sending 26 competitor­s, Fitzroy 15 and NPOB with 11 surf athletes competing recently at Gisborne’s Midway Beach.

Fitzroy finished top of the Taranaki clubs in tenth place with 34 points while East End finished two places behind their neighbours in twelfth place overall with 24 points. Although going close to medalling in several finals, the young NPOB team did not gain any podium finishes. First place was taken out by Mount Maunganui, with Mairangi Bay from Auckland in second and Gisborne’s Waikanae club in third.

Top performers for Fitzroy in individual events were gold medallists Zac Reid (under 19 surf swim), Joe Collins (under 16 ironman), Ryan Clough (under 16 surf ski), and Sasha Reid (under 16 run, swim, run).

Picking up silver medals for Fitzroy were Javon McCallum (open beach sprint) Zac Reid (under 19 run, swim, run) and Sasha Reid in the under 16 women’s surf swim. Team medals for Fitzroy came in the under 16 men’s board rescue (gold), the under 16 women’s tube rescue (silver), the under 19 men’s tube rescue (silver) and the under 19 men’s board rescue (bronze).

Individual medallists for East End were Lucy North who won gold in under 16 women’s surf swim, silver in the diamond race and bronze in the run, swim, run. East End’s other leading performer was Hannah Baker who, competing in the under 19 women’s section, took out gold in the surf ski final as well as collecting gold with her team mates in the double ski and ski relay. East End’s other team medals came in the under 19 women’s Taplin relay (silver), the under 19 women’s board rescue (bronze) and the under 16 women’s tube rescue.

At the conclusion of the Nationals, seven Taranaki surf athletes were named in New Zealand rep squads with Claudia Kelly, Hannah Baker and Lucy North (all East End) together with Fitzroy’s Joe Collins, Zac Reid and Sasha Reid selected for the NZ Youth Squad. Javon McCallum (Fitzroy) was chosen in the Senior Developmen­t Squad.
